"Driving Spirit" The Joe Crawford Harrod Memorial Grant

Driving Spirit, the Joe Crawford Harrod Memorial Grant has been established to support active youth members of the American Hackney Horse Society, aged 18-26, with a desire to develop their horsemanship and showmanship skills. Funds may be used for equine industry educational programs, internships or any show horse industry program or endeavor. The grant will be awarded annually, in an amount up to $2,500.

Requirements:

Youth must be an active member of the American Hackney Horse Society
Youth may be an amateur or professional
Youth must participate in the show horse industry
Grant is open to Hackney, Saddlebred, Morgan and Roadster Youth

The intention of the grant is to recognize and support an individual who portrays the characteristics and traits that Joe Crawford Harrod strived for and pursued.

Applicant must demonstrate:
Excellent Sportsmanship
Value of Camaraderie & Friendship
Value of Teamwork & Confidence Building
Care and Compassion for Ponies/Horses

To apply for the Grant:
Along with at least 2 recommendations from active participants in the show horse industry, the applicant must submit a written essay and/or a 2-3 minute video outlining:
Program, school, internship, work-study, or other show horse activity for which the applicant will use the Grant Funds
Purpose for applying for the Grant Funds
Goals the applicant will achieve by the use of the Grant Funds
Amount the applicant is requesting (up to $2,500)
Contact Information (address, phone, e-mail)
